    My DH made my thread cone holder with an empty CD holder and stiff wire. Works great! I also saw an online picture of a piece of coat hanger wire with a loop bent into one end taped to the top of a sewing machine so the loop sticks out behind the machine and over a thread cone in a mug.

I never thought of using cones for my sewing machine, and the one I use for quilting, I don't know if a cone holder would stay while the carriage is moving over the quilt. I have a question, though. Do you have a problem winding a bobin with a cone holder? I would think the tension would be a problem, but maybe not.

    I don't have any problems winding bobbins from a cone. I run the thread through the bobbin winder tension guide on the sewing machine like I would with a regular spool.
